Uji Mekanis Beton Menggunakan Agregat Sungai Plasma Kabupaten Luwu Utara Asni Tandiara; Jujun Sanggaria, Olan; Tonapa, Suryanti Rapang
Paulus Civil Engineering Journal Vol. 7 No. 1 (2025): PCEJ Vol.7, No.1, Maret 2025

Abstract

Aggregate from the Plasma River in North Luwu Regency has been widely used by the local community for construction, but there has been no research assessing the quality of aggregate in the construction sector. The research was carried out to determine the mechanical properties of compressive strength, split tensile strength, flexural strength and modulus of elasticity. This research took place in the structure and materials laboratory, Civil Engineering study program, Paulus Indonesian Christian University using the SNI 7656 – 2012 method, test objects in the form of cylinders (Ø 15 cm × height 30 cm), and blocks (60 cm × 15 cm × 15 cm). The compressive strength of the concrete was tested at the ages of 3, 7, 21 and 28 days and the split tensile strength, flexural strength of the concrete and modulus of elasticity were tested at the age of 28 days. From the research results, with a design quality of 25 MPa and 32 MPa, Plasma River aggregate is suitable for use in concrete mixtures.
